Transaction 804e503d32e50c95a5219efc6e1e7d2e774817faf80a2df5bedf5876b8bce06a

1 Input
1 Outputs
  • 804e503d32e50c95a5219efc6e1e7d2e774817faf80a2df5bedf5876b8bce06a:0
  • value  1144500
    address  1CgL657ZTSBmwiK6gV2H9cffg6ZxqnKs2F